TOMISLAVGRAD, September 22 (FENA) - Jelovača wind farm, Tušnica wind farm and Zvizdan solar park will be part of the basic pillar of the Federation of BiH's energy system in the near future, said FBiH Minister of Energy, Mining and Industry Nermin Džindić during his visit to Jelovača wind farm near Tomislavgrad.
“The Jelovača wind farm was put into operation at the end of 2019. The total value of the investment was 45m euros. Here you can see 18 units of 2 megawatts each, with a total installed capacity of 36 megawatts, and it is a private investor,” said Minister Džindić in a statement for FENA.
The same investor is working on two new projects: the Tušnica wind farm with a total installed capacity of 72.6 megawatts (project value around 100 million euros) and the Zvizdan solar park with 23 megawatts of installed capacity (project value is around 20 million euros).
The Tušnica wind farm should be in operation by the end of 2023, as well as the Zvizdan solar park.
The total installed capacity in these three projects is about 130 megawatts, and the total value of the investment is over 150 million euros.
